[ACPI] ACPICA 20051216

Implemented optional support to allow unresolved names
within ASL Package objects. A null object is inserted in
the package when a named reference cannot be located in
the current namespace. Enabled via the interpreter slack
flag which Linux has enabled by default (acpi=strict
to disable slack).  This should eliminate AE_NOT_FOUND
exceptions seen on machines that contain such code.

Implemented an optimization to the initialization
sequence that can improve boot time. During ACPI device
initialization, the _STA method is now run if and only
if the _INI method exists. The _STA method is used to
determine if the device is present; An _INI can only be
run if _STA returns present, but it is a waste of time to
run the _STA method if the _INI does not exist. (Prototype
and assistance from Dong Wei)

Implemented use of the C99 uintptr_t for the pointer
casting macros if it is available in the current
compiler. Otherwise, the default (void *) cast is used
as before.

Fixed some possible memory leaks found within the
execution path of the Break, Continue, If, and CreateField
operators. (Valery Podrezov)

Fixed a problem introduced in the 20051202 release where
an exception is generated during method execution if a
control method attempts to declare another method.
